0. Abstract

   RFC1403 [RFC1403], "BGP OSPF Interaction" describes technology
   which is no longer used.  This document requests that RFC 1403 be
   moved to historic status. 

1. Details

   During a review of internet standards relating to BGP, it became
   apparent that BGP OSPF interaction, as described in RFC1403, is not 
   common usage (if at all), and requires significant implementation 
   complexity. Since this mechanism has not been in use in the public 
   internet for many years (if ever), it is proposed to reclassify 
   it to historic.
